Transit safety and security certification is the formal process used to verify that new or modified rail lines, stations, vehicles, and systems are safe to enter passenger service. It captures hazard analyses, design reviews, test results, training records, operational readiness checks, and other evidence in a documented Certifiable Items List.
Certification matters because it demonstrates to regulators, boards, the public, and the agency’s own safety leadership that every safety-critical element has been designed, built, tested, and accepted before opening day. For rail transit, FTA and State Safety Oversight Agencies expect a rigorous certification process on major capital projects.
A Certifiable Items List, or CIL, is the master inventory of elements that must be certified before a system can enter revenue service. Items typically include signals, communications, traction power, vehicles, stations, maintenance facilities, operating rules, emergency procedures, and training programs.
The CIL is developed early in the project, refined as design progresses, and verified systematically during construction, testing, and pre-revenue operations. Each item on the list has defined acceptance criteria and evidence requirements, so by the time the project is ready to open, the certification file contains a clear paper trail of decisions, tests, and approvals.
Safety and security certification should begin during preliminary engineering and continue through revenue service launch. Starting late is one of the most common and costly mistakes on capital projects, because decisions made during design lock in hazards that become expensive to mitigate during construction and nearly impossible to address after opening.
Experienced teams embed safety and security certification into project management from the start, aligning it with design review milestones, procurement decisions, and test planning. This approach surfaces safety issues while design changes are still cheap and prevents the last-minute discoveries that delay opening dates.
Final safety and security certification is typically signed by senior agency officials, often including the general manager, chief safety officer, and project executive. For rail transit systems subject to State Safety Oversight, the SSO Agency also reviews and approves certification before pre-passenger service safety assessments are completed.
The stakes are high because professional reputations, public trust, and regulatory relationships all depend on the certification being honest and complete. A safety event shortly after opening that traces back to an item certified without adequate evidence damages not only the specific project but the credibility of the agency’s entire safety program, which is why disciplined certification processes matter far beyond any single opening day.
The Federal Transit Administration’s Circular 5800.1 established safety certification requirements for FTA projects several years ago. More recently, the American Public Transportation Association issued a safety and security certification recommended practice to update and augment FTA requirements. At the same time, the Comité Européen de Normalisation Électrotechnique, or CENELEC, maintains a certification framework that takes a different approach but is also sometimes used in North American transit projects.
